Ask About Safety Equipment

One thing I always recommend is confirming that the catamaran includes proper safety equipment before your trip begins. A professional crew should be happy to explain their safety measures clearly.

You should look for

  • Life jackets for all passengers

  • Emergency communication equipment

  • First aid supplies onboard

  • Experienced and licensed crew members

  • Clear safety instructions before departure

These details may seem basic, but they can make a huge difference during unexpected situations.

Follow Crew Instructions Carefully

Even if you have previous boating experience, it is still important to follow the instructions provided by the local crew. Every boat and ocean area can have different safety procedures.

Listen During Safety Briefings

Many travelers ignore safety demonstrations because they are eager to start the tour quickly. I always recommend paying close attention because these instructions are designed to protect everyone onboard.

Respect Water Activity Limits

Swimming, snorkeling, and diving activities should always follow crew guidance and local conditions. Staying within designated safe areas reduces unnecessary risks.

Avoid Unsafe Behavior

Running on wet surfaces or ignoring crew instructions can quickly create accidents. A relaxed and respectful attitude helps everyone enjoy the trip more safely.

Pack Smart for Comfort and Safety

What you bring on a catamaran tour can also affect your overall experience. Punta Cana’s tropical weather often feels warm and sunny throughout the day, so preparation matters.

I usually suggest bringing

  • Reef safe sunscreen

  • Sunglasses and hats

  • Non slip sandals

  • Waterproof phone protection

  • Light and breathable clothing

Packing wisely helps you stay comfortable while reducing small problems that could affect your trip.

Understand Your Physical Comfort Level

Not everyone feels comfortable on open water for long periods. If you are prone to seasickness or traveling with children or older family members, it helps to plan ahead.

Simple preparation such as staying hydrated, eating light meals before departure, and choosing calmer sailing times can improve comfort significantly.

Being honest about your comfort level allows you to choose the right type of catamaran experience for your needs.
